GoPro Hero 5 Release: Action Cam Waiting for Karma Drone, To Debut With Improved Connectivity Features

The GoPro Hero 5's release has been waited by the company's patrons for a while now. Although the upcoming Hero device is ready to debut, it is still reportedly waiting for the Karma Drone. The new sports camera is expected to armed with an improved connectivity feature.

According to Christian Today, the Hero 5 is ready to be unveiled but GoPro is still waiting for the final version of its other upcoming device, the Karma drone. As per tech analysts, Hero fans may expect two GoPro launches in the latter part of the year, with the GoPro Hero 5 reportedly arriving in October.

As it was speculated, the GoPro Hero 5 will be released on the latter half of 2016 and the industry followers have stated that this may be the perfect timeframe for the Karma drone to make its way to the market. In addition, having an almost simultaneous launch with the GoPro Hero 5 will be a good scheme for the company.

It was also reported that the features of the Karma drone itself is one of the indirect reasons why GoPro delayed the Hero 5's release. The company has stated that the upcoming Karma drone is compatible with both past and future GoPro action cams. This basically means that the drone should be launched before the new Hero 5, so that owners of GoPro action cams can check out the drone first for them to decide whether they want an upgrade or not.

Aside from the release date, Ecumenical News noted that GoPro CEO Nicholas Woodman revealed the company's plans to reorganize its lineup. The company will stop selling the Hero and Hero LCD cameras by April. Instead, it will focus on selling the Hero 4 Session, Silver and Black cameras.

Woodman also stated that later this year, the company will be unveiling the most connected and convenient GoPro it has ever made, Hero 5. He revealed that the upcoming member of the Hero family along with other future products will be developed with more connectivity features. Users will be able connect the GoPro action cameras to their smartphones with ease and it would also be easier for them to save photos onto the cloud.

As previously reported, the GoPro Hero 5 might be armed with the Ambarella H1 System on chip that will enable users to record videos using 4k resolution at 60 frames per second. It was noted that GoPro Hero 4 Black functions at the same resolution, but the upcoming action camera will have a higher speed. The GoPro Hero 5 is also believed to have an improved 2.7k performance as well as higher frame rates for 1080p video capturing. Apart from that, the upcoming member of the Hero family is also predicted to be able to film at a depth of 60 meters, a mile higher from Hero 4's 20-meter capacity.

Although the exact schedule of the GoPro Hero 5's release date is not yet confirmed, it is nice to know that the upcoming sport camera is armed with several improvements. Furthermore, just like the previous Hero cameras, it could be paired with the company's first drone, Karma.
